PENGARUH PEMBIAYAAN BERMASALAH DAN EFISIENSI OPERASIONAL TERHADAP PROFITABILITAS UNIT PENGELOLA KEGIATAN KECAMATAN SEJANGKUNG PERIODE 2018-2022 azura, azura
Cross-Border Journal of Business Management Vol. 4 No. 1 (2024): Cross-Border Journal of Business Management
Publisher : Institut Agama Islam Sultan Muhammaad Syafiuddin Sambas

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ar

Abstract

This research was motivated by the gap between theory and practice, this happened in 2020 where the NPF ratio increased by 59.9% from the previous year of 23.94%. This also led to an increase in ROA of 5.92% from the previous year of 4.63%, supposedly if NPF increases then ROA will decrease. This is supported by a theory that explains that the higher the problematic financing, the lower the level of profitability of financial institutions. This research uses quantitative methods, the data used is secondary data, namely monthly financial statements for the 2018-2022 period obtained from the financial statement book of the Sejangkung Subdistrict Activities Management Unit. The data analysis method used is multiple linear regression analysis using classical assumption tests first, for data processing researchers use SPSS statistical test tool version 23. The hypothesis tests carried out are the coefficient of determination test, F test, t test and dominant test. The results of the study based on SPSS output show that problematic financing variables have a positive and insignificant effect on profitability and operational efficiency variables have a negative and significant effect on profitability. Meanwhile, simultaneously the variables of problematic financing and operational efficiency have a significant effect on profitability. The R Square obtained in this study amounted to 21.4% and the rest was influenced by other factors.
Resistance Profile Antibiotics Pathogenic Bacteria from SWAB Wounds of Pontianak City Diabetes Treatment Clinic Patients azura, Azura; Sri Tumpuk; Ari Nuswantoro
Jurnal EduHealth Vol. 14 No. 04 (2023): Jurnal eduHealt, 2023, December
Publisher : Sean Institute

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ar

Abstract

Diabetes mellitus (DM) is a type of metabolic disorder where the sufferer has high blood sugar levels due to the body's failure to respond or produces insufficient amounts of insulin, or a metabolic disorder caused by hyperglycemia due to abnormalities in insulin secretion and insulin action or both. One of the complications of diabetes is ulcers, where a superficial infection occurs on the sufferer's skin and becomes a strategic location for bacterial growth. Most of the drugs that are widely used to inhibit or kill bacteria that cause infections in humans are antibiotics which carry the risk of drug resistance. Antibiotic resistance is a growing problem in many parts of the world. Antibiotic resistance can occur due to inappropriate or excessive use of antibiotics. This study aims to determine the susceptibility of pathogenic bacteria to several antimicrobial agents or antibiotics and to determine the percentage of antibiotic resistance in diabetes mellitus patients who experience complications, which will make it easier to choose the right antibiotic for healing. This research uses a descriptive method using samples of bacterial isolates which have been identified as 11 samples of Staphylococcus aureus bacterial isolates, 11 samples of Pseudomonas aeruginosa isolates and 39 samples of Klebsiella pneumoniae bacterial isolates. Antimicrobial susceptibility test (AST) disk diffusion method (Kirby & Bauer test) using Mueller Hinton media. With eight different types of antibiotics, this test was carried out to prove antimicrobial activity by measuring the diameter of the antimicrobial activity inhibition zone. Resistance test results were obtained in Staphylococcus aureus experiencing the highest resistance to the antibiotic Gentamycin (CN) at 63.63%, in Pseudomonas aeruginosa experiencing high resistance to the antibiotic Ampicillin (AMP) at 54.54%, and in Klebsiella pneumoniae experiencing the highest resistance. against the antibiotic Ampicillin (AMP) was 41.02%. Preventing antibiotic resistance in wound healing is very important to ensure antibiotics remain effective in treating infections. Therefore, this research was carried out in order to determine the correct type of antibiotic for healing wounds in diabetes mellitus sufferers.
Menggali Nilai-Nilai Kearifan Lokal Sebagai Identitas Budaya Riau Ishami, Nur; Azura, Azura; Nurkhasanah, Ayu; Nurjanah, Nurjanah; Sonia, Sonia; Miski, Cut Raudhatul
Maharsi: Jurnal Pendidikan Sejarah dan Sosiologi Vol. 7 No. 2 (2025): Maharsi : Jurnal Pendidikan Sejarah dan Sosiologi
Publisher : UNIVERSITAS INSAN BUDI UTOMO

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ar | DOI: 10.33503/maharsi.v7i2.1618

Abstract

Penelitian ini membahas peran kearifan lokal sebagai warisan budaya yang memperkuat identitas masyarakat di Provinsi Riau. Kearifan lokal dipahami sebagai nilai-nilai, norma, dan tradisi yang diwariskan secara turun-temurun dan menjadi bagian integral dari kehidupan sosial, budaya, dan spiritual masyarakat. Melalui pendekatan deskriptif- kualitatif, kajian ini menggali beragam bentuk kearifan lokal di Riau, seperti Nyanyi Panjang, Besesombau, Manolam, Gurindam Dua Belas, Pacu Jalur, Mandi Balimau, Ritual Tolak Bala, dan Festival Lampu Colok. Setiap tradisi mengandung nilai-nilai luhur seperti gotong royong, religiusitas, solidaritas, estetika, serta pelestarian lingkungan dan budaya. Hasil penelitian menunjukkan bahwa kearifan lokal tidak hanya berfungsi sebagai identitas budaya, tetapi juga sebagai media pendidikan karakter, ketahanan sosial, dan penolak dampak negatif globalisasi. Oleh karena itu, pelestarian dan penguatan kearifan lokal menjadi penting dalam menjaga ati diri budaya dan membangun masyarakat yang berkarakter.
